Jaipur's Smart City Initiatives Enhance Tourism Experience

Jaipur, the capital of Rajasthan, is undergoing significant transformations to bolster its tourism sector through smart city initiatives. These developments aim to integrate technology with the city's rich cultural heritage, enhancing the overall visitor experience.

Smart Infrastructure and Heritage Conservation

The Jaipur Development Authority (JDA) has partnered with the forest department to develop eco-tourism projects in forest areas. Notably, the Beed Govindpura and Beed Goner regions are being developed to protect these areas from encroachment and provide a clean environment for residents and wildlife. Additionally, the JDA is funding the forest department to develop the Amagarh and Lalveri forest blocks adjoining the Jhalana Leopard Reserve, aiming to improve the habitat for leopards and other wildlife. These initiatives are expected to attract more tourists and promote sustainable tourism practices.

Digital Integration in Tourism

Efforts are underway to digitize Jaipur's heritage sites, including the Rajasthan Legislative Assembly Building and the Maharaja Library, to preserve and promote the city's history. These digital initiatives aim to make cultural information more accessible to visitors and enhance the educational aspect of tourism.

Transportation Enhancements

To improve connectivity, the Jaipur Metro's Pink Line, which connects Mansarovar to Badi Chaupar, has been extended to include two additional stations, Chhoti Chaupar and Badi Chaupar. This extension facilitates easier access to key tourist destinations within the city.

Environmental Sustainability

Jaipur is implementing nature-based solutions to address urban challenges such as water scarcity, flooding, and pollution. Initiatives include the development of rooftop gardens, urban forestry campaigns, and the restoration of lakes like Mansagar Lake, which now supports over 100 bird species and other wildlife. These efforts aim to make the city more livable and attractive to eco-conscious tourists.

Through these integrated smart city initiatives, Jaipur is enhancing its appeal as a tourist destination by combining technological advancements with cultural preservation and environmental sustainability.
